Apple squeezing PC rivals trying to use lith-poly batteries

Apple's heavy use of lithium-polymer batteries in MacBooks is making it difficult for other notebook makers to get supply of their own, battery suppliers claimed Thursday. The Mac maker has supposedly secured so much supply that companies hoping to get into ultraportable notebooks in earnest, such as Acer, ASUS, Dell, and HP, are scrambling to find alternate sources. The firms were said by Digitimes to be counting on increased production across southeast Asia....
